Is Your Zero B Purifier Showing These Signs?
These are the complaints we attend most often in Hunsur:
- Bad taste or smell: a change in taste is often the first sign that filters are due.
- Water leaking from the unit: water collecting under the purifier or on the wall.
- Purifier not turning on: a failed SMPS, adapter or wiring fault.
- UV light not working: a lamp that has reached end of life or a faulty UV circuit.
- Purifier not switching off: a faulty float valve, solenoid valve or pressure switch.
How to Get the Best from Your Zero B RO
You can avoid many breakdowns with a little care:
- Use the purifier daily; water left standing for days in the tank is not ideal.
- Get the RO membrane checked once a year; it typically lasts 1 to 2 years depending on water quality.
- Watch for slower filling or a change in taste; both are early warning signs.
- Keep the inlet valve and drain line free of kinks.
